An interesting thing here. That box in front of the rear wheel, there are probably 2, one on each side and these contained sand or similar for help in winter on slippery roads. If I remember correctly, these could be activated from the driver's seat, so if the wheels started to spin, the driver could easily get sand on the wheels and gain traction. This was probably very necessary on a 4x2 truck with 2 trailers.

Wonder how you get the Viva and the row of cars next to it out? Wait until the others have left.

Apart from a Volvo Amazon (?) not a foreign car in sight - and not a hatchback.

Compared to what was happening in Europe most of these old dinosaurs were on borrowed time once imports took off and people could buy the kind of cars they wanted rather than what they were given by out of touch British manufacturers. Photo is 1967 given the HB Vivas, new Minx, Escort and Cortina 2  shown.
